What do you mean by that? FM Transmitter?

My guess would be he hooks it up to a physical FM transmitter, like an iTrip for the iPod/iPhone, but one that goes in a 3.5mm jack instead of the proprietary iPod plug. You tune your car stereo to a station that doesn't have a clear signal otherwise, and set the transmitter to broadcast to that station. Simple to use, but I prefer a straight aux jack in car stereos.

sorry, dumb question, what's 1x4, 2x4, 4x1, etc?? is it width? are the widgets customizeable? Thanks

They are not customizable, but some programs have different widgets. They mean dimensions of space they take up. Your screen has 16 squares (4 over, 4 down), so a 4x1 widget means it takes up 4 over, 1 down. An icon is 1x1, as it takes up only one square.
